Membrane Protein Identification via Multi-view Graph Regularized k-Local Hyperplane Distance Nearest Neighbor Model
Abstract
X-ray diffraction and nuclear magnetic resonance spectroscopy are the main methods for measuring membrane proteins. The traditional methods are time-consuming and labor-intensive. To large-scale prediction and screening of membrane proteins, a graph regularized k-local hyperplane distance nearest neighbor model (GHKNN) is proposed to identify of membrane protein types.
